How to Monitor Your Intensity with Perceived Exertion 

When exercising, it's important to monitor your intensity to make sure you're working at a pace that is challenging enough to help you reach your goals, but not so hard that you blow a lung. One way to do that is to use a Perceived Exertion Scale.

How to Monitor Your Intensity 

 When it comes to exercise, how hard you work can make a big difference in how many calories you burn and your ability to build stamina and endurance. There are a number of ways to monitor your intensity to make sure you're working in yourtarget heart rate zone, which will help you get the most out of your exercise time.
